49 static struct ofw_compat_data compat_data[] = {
50 	{"nxp,pca9547",		1},
51 	{NULL,			0}
52 };
53 IICBUS_FDT_PNP_INFO(compat_data);
54 
55 #include <dev/iicbus/mux/iicmux.h>
56 
57 struct pca9547_softc {
58 	struct iicmux_softc mux;
59 	device_t	dev;
60 	bool idle_disconnect;
61 };
62 
63 static int
64 pca9547_bus_select(device_t dev, int busidx, struct iic_reqbus_data *rd)
65 {
66 	struct pca9547_softc *sc = device_get_softc(dev);
67 	uint8_t busbits;
68 
69 	/*
70 	 * The iicmux caller ensures busidx is between 0 and the number of buses
71 	 * we passed to iicmux_init_softc(), no need for validation here.  If
72 	 * the fdt data has the idle_disconnect property we idle the bus by
73 	 * selecting no downstream buses, otherwise we just leave the current
74 	 * bus active.  The upper bits of control register 3 activate the
75 	 * downstream buses; bit 7 is the first bus, bit 6 the second, etc.
76 	 */
77 	if (busidx == IICMUX_SELECT_IDLE) {
78 		if (sc->idle_disconnect)
79 			busbits = 0;
80 		else
81 			return (0);
82 	} else {
83 		busbits = 0x8 | (busidx & 0x7);
84 	}
85 
86 	/*
87 	 * We have to add the IIC_RECURSIVE flag because the iicmux core has
88 	 * already reserved the bus for us, and iicdev_writeto() is going to try
89 	 * to reserve it again, which is allowed with the recursive flag.
90 	 */
91 
92 	return (iicdev_writeto(dev, busbits, NULL, 0,
93 	    rd->flags | IIC_RECURSIVE));
94 }
95 
96 static int
97 pca9547_probe(device_t dev)
98 {
99 	if (!ofw_bus_status_okay(dev))
100 		return (ENXIO);
101 
102 	if (!ofw_bus_search_compatible(dev, compat_data)->ocd_data)
103 		return (ENXIO);
104 
105 	device_set_desc(dev, "PCA9547 IIC bus multiplexor");
106 	return (BUS_PROBE_DEFAULT);
107 }
108 
109 static int
110 pca9547_attach(device_t dev)
111 {
112 	struct pca9547_softc *sc;
113 	phandle_t node;
114 	int rv;
115 
116 	sc = device_get_softc(dev);
117 	sc ->dev = dev;
118 
119 	node = ofw_bus_get_node(dev);
120 	sc->idle_disconnect = OF_hasprop(node, "i2c-mux-idle-disconnect");
121 
122 	rv = iicmux_attach(sc->dev, device_get_parent(dev), 8);
123 	if (rv != 0)
124 		return (rv);
125 	rv = bus_generic_attach(dev);
126 
127 	return (rv);
128 }
129 
130 static int
131 pca9547_detach(device_t dev)
132 {
133 	int rv;
134 
135 	rv = iicmux_detach(dev);
136 	if (rv != 0)
137 		return (rv);
138 
139 	return (0);
140 }
141 
142 static device_method_t pca9547_methods[] = {
143 	/* device methods */
144 	DEVMETHOD(device_probe,			pca9547_probe),
145 	DEVMETHOD(device_attach,		pca9547_attach),
146 	DEVMETHOD(device_detach,		pca9547_detach),
147 
148 	/* iicmux methods */
149 	DEVMETHOD(iicmux_bus_select,		pca9547_bus_select),
150 
151 	DEVMETHOD_END
152 };
153 
154 static devclass_t pca9547_devclass;
155 DEFINE_CLASS_1(iicmux, pca9547_driver, pca9547_methods,
156     sizeof(struct pca9547_softc), iicmux_driver);
157 DRIVER_MODULE(pca_iicmux, iicbus, pca9547_driver, pca9547_devclass, 0, 0);
158 DRIVER_MODULE(iicbus, iicmux, iicbus_driver, iicbus_devclass, 0, 0);
159 DRIVER_MODULE(ofw_iicbus, iicmux, ofw_iicbus_driver, ofw_iicbus_devclass,
160     0, 0);
161 MODULE_DEPEND(pca9547, iicmux, 1, 1, 1);
162 MODULE_DEPEND(pca9547, iicbus, 1, 1, 1);
